Tethering

If you have a smartphone, Telcotalk have a range of plans where we can enable Tethering.

For those of you who dont know yet, Tethering allows you to use your smartphone as a wireless modem! this means you can use the data allowance on your mobile phone plan to connect to the net wirelessly with you laptop or tablet.

Also for those of you who are thinking of investing in a tablet save yourself some money and don't bother with the more expensive 3G version, you have a 3G connection on your mobile you can use.

So here's what you need to do, first contact us and ask us to enable tethering for your device then....

if its an Iphone you have then follow these steps-

settings>

general>

network>

personal hotspot> turn ON

now you have a few options for connection,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th or USB,

personally for security purposes where available I would choose USB but obviously if you are tethering to an Ipad then you wont have this option, so go for Wi-Fi or Bluetooth.

Then on your laptop or tablet enter the network options tab and select your Iphone, and you are now connected!

 

The wide range of Android handsets mean setup will vary but look for your personal hotspot in your networks tab and you should be able to activate it just as easily as the Iphone setup. A quick word of warning before you go wild! -ensure you have a good data allowance before tethering as browsing on your laptop and tablet will use up more data than your Smartphone.

 

Remember you have to call to have the feature enabled as generally mobile plans won't automatically feature tethering as standard.
